The Historical Significance of the Eye of Horus
The Eye of Horus originates from Egyptian mythology, representing protection, royal power, and good health. Historically, it was associated with the falcon-headed god Horus, symbolising protection against evil and promoting harmony in the universe. Artefacts and hieroglyphs depicting the Eye are found throughout Egyptian relics, underscoring its importance in spiritual and cultural contexts.
